Hi bertus, I cannot see any problem in the code you posted. Just some ideas: What is the value of D_ANGLE_TOL? - Do you need the assignment bAbort := NOT bDecoder? Does it help to leave it out? Any errors (e.g. SMC_SmoothPath.Error/ErrorID) or PLC log messages? What if you comment out SMC_SmoothMerge and SMC_LimtiDynamics, is corner smoothing still not working? Is bDecode written from a different task (e.g. visu)? Then I would recommend to assign to a local variable (bDecodeLocal := bDecode) and use that for all FBs. Otherwise, FBs might see different values of bDecode in a single cycle, which will cause problems. Regards, Georg

Post by gseidel on Scara3 kinematic robot error
CODESYS Forge
talk
(Post)
Hi aniket-b, this error has nothing to do with the scara3 kinematics, or robotics, or SoftMotion. It means that the EtherCAT bus is not synchronized. The usual cause is that the realtime of the PLC is not sufficient. See https://content.helpme-codesys.com/en/CODESYS%20SoftMotion/_sm_basic_common_errors.html for details and ways to solve the problem. You can also check the PLC log for additional information about the error. Best regards, Georg
